Set01
1月前来过
全职 · 412/日  ·  8961/月
工作时间: 工作日18:30-22:00、周末08:00-22:00工作地点: 远程
服务企业: 1家累计提交: 0工时
联系方式:
********
********
********
聊一聊

使用APP扫码聊一聊

个人介绍

1.熟练掌握JavaSE基础知识,熟悉常用的设计模式(单例、代理、工厂、建造者、策略、观察者等)及反射、自

定义注解、泛型、自定义枚举等。

2.熟练使用SpringSpringMVC mybatits-plusspring-data-jpaSpringBoot等WEB开源框架,熟悉spring的

IOC、DI、AOP设计思想,了解IOC和AOP底层原理。

3,有深入研究过ConurrentHashMap/HashMapArraylistLinkedList集合框架源码底层实现;

4.熟悉并熟练使用KafkaRedisESNacos等常用中间件,并处理过Kafka避免重复消费、消息堆积、数据丢失、

顺序一致性等问题,了解Redis缓存雪崩、缓存击穿、缓存穿透等情景以及解决方案。

5.熟练使用springcloud微服务框架并有相关开发经验,有深入研究过分布式事务解决方案Base/CAP理论、柔性与

刚性事务、最终一致性思想,了解服务雪崩、服务降级、限流等思想。

6.熟悉并熟练使用MYSQLoracle等主流关系型数据库。

7.熟悉linux平台下常用命令操作、环境部署。

8.熟悉Docker容器的使用。熟练使用VMware安装虚拟机。

9.能够搭建HDFS分布式文件存储系统、zookpeer集群,并具有相应开发经验;

10.熟练使用 IDEA/ EcliseSVNGitMaven等开发及版本控制工具, 熟练Web 应用系统开发,具备独立开发能

力;

11.熟悉基础的web前端开发:HTML+CSS+JS,JavaScript/AJAXjQuery,熟练使用Element UILayUIEasyui

bootstrap等前端框架,并能对相关框架方法进行重写。

12、熟练使用Ffmpeg+nginx、javaCV等流媒体服务器插件,实现直播以及摄像头录制视频、截取图片等功能。

13、 熟悉常用的互联网技术组件及中间件(

TomcatNginx等 )

大数据方面:

1.熟悉hadoop生态及kafka相关各种工具,掌握Zookeeper选举机制,并能够借助Zookeeper搭建Hadoop集群搭建并

有实际搭建经验及Yarn调度流程。

2.熟练掌握Flink常见算子的使用,熟悉Flink架构及作业提交流程,对批量计算、流式计算、时序数据处理具有

实际项目的开发经验; 

工作经历

  • 2019-07-01 -2022-04-01方正国际软件有限公司java开发工程师

    1. 负责调度信息的存储、创建、以及修改。包括作业调度周期、并行度、超时时间、作业调度时间等信息的 下发、作业开始、作业停止,并将调度信息缓存到Redis中间件中。 2. 负责数据监控服务,pull 拉取kafka订阅数据信息(包括正确数据量、问题数据量)日志信息,对kafka 消息进行过滤,避免重复消费、数据丢失等问题。最后将消息保存到MySQL中,并组装作业监控数据。错误数据 记录以及错误信息保存到tidb中。 3. 使用任务调度框架quartz保证kafka拉取线程断线重启。 4. 使用flink负责ETL组件开发,数据源组件(kafka输入、json文件读取、mysql读取、Excel文件读取)、 中间清洗节点(数据拆分、数据格转、数据流合并、过滤)、存储节点(kafka 写入、json文件写入)、mysql 存储)等组件的开发并打包上传HDFS分布式文件服务器

教育经历

  • 2015-07-02 - 2019-07-01青岛农业大学计算机科学与技术本科

技能

0
1
2
3
4
5
0
1
2
3
4
5
作品
xx园林智能灌溉系统

智慧园林项目是面向园林公司,为园林公司的管理人员及工作人员服务,旨在为园林公司实现精细化 作业、智能化管理、减少养护成本,提高园林养护人员工作效率,降低工作强度。 参与模块的概要设计和详细设计。 使用newScheduledThreadPool线程池实现定时灌溉、根据土壤湿度等条件自动控制开启电磁阀的开关,达到智 能灌溉的目的。 使用TimerTask定时线程定时检查水阀状态,编写水阀异常强制关闭保护机制。编写土壤气象数据的实时显示 等功能。 .负责项目的部署和发布。

0
2023-04-20 09:51
高铁多模主动探测阵列系统

主动探测阵列系统是针对高铁安防安全所做的一款产品,围绕以光电探测器为主要探测手段,依托实 时监控、主机信息采集、光电设备的指令下发、防区管理、行为探测、报警信息推送等服务,实时检测实体防护 或电子防护的封闭区域边界的人员入侵行为,能实时检测探测设备的实时状态,能发出实时报警提示,以及对报 警行为进行推送和处理。 负责摄像头信息 、防区管理、布撤防管理、旁路设置、升级文件的上传和设备升级命令的下发、实时监控、视 频回放等模块的开发与设计并使用elementUI、AJAX、JavaScript等实现前端页面展示与渲染。负责搭建视频流媒体服务器,并调研实现摄像头web端无插件直播以及报警后录制报警视频、截取图片等功能。从kafka订阅入侵报警信息,对报警消息进行去重、过滤等处理、设备升级指令的下发、主机监控等部分进行开 发。负责项目在linux系统的安装与部署。

0
2023-04-20 09:56
大数据治理平台

数据治理基于作业调度与数据处理为一体,分布式调度系统的开发,可以为数据治理提供独立,全面 的任务编排,调度管理,执行管理,监控等功能,为数据治理提供强大的作业调度、作业执行的底层支持。用 于对Oracle、MySQL、SQL Server、GBase、TiDB、Hive、Kafka、GaussDB等多源异构数据的抽取、清洗、整合 以及转换。通过强大的ETL组件管理,算法包管理,实现跨平台数据资源的多源汇聚、快速清洗和数据治理。 负责调度信息的存储、创建、以及修改。包括作业调度周期、并行度、超时时间、作业调度时间等信息的 下发、作业开始、作业停止,并将调度信息缓存到Redis中间件中。 2. 负责数据监控服务,pull 拉取kafka订阅数据信息(包括正确数据量、问题数据量)日志信息,对kafka 消息进行过滤,避免重复消费、数据丢失等问题。最后将消息保存到MySQL中,并组装作业监控数据。错误数据 记录以及错误信息保存到tidb中。 3. 使用任务调度框架quartz保证kafka拉取线程断线重启。 4. 使用flink负责ETL组件开发,数据源组件(kafka输入、json文件读取、mysql读取、Excel文件读取)、 中间清洗节点(数据拆分、数据格转、数据流合并、过滤)、存储节点(kafka 写入、json文件写入)、mysql 存储)等组件的开发并打包上传HDFS分布式文件服务器。

0
2023-04-20 09:57
更新于: 2022-08-29 浏览: 124